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 01.06.2008, 19:42   #11
ACE Valery
Сама себе режиссер
Старожил
 
Аватар для ACE Valery
 
Регистрация: 27.04.2007
Сообщений: 3,365
По умолчанию

Код:
for(int i = 0; i < n; i++)
{
        cout<<mas[i]<<" ";
}
Если я вас напрягаю или раздражаю, вы всегда можете забиться в угол и поплакать
ACE Valery вне форума Ответить с цитированием
Старый 01.06.2008, 19:45   #12
Rembo
Форумчанин
 
Аватар для Rembo
 
Регистрация: 29.10.2007
Сообщений: 628
По умолчанию

Присоединяюсь в Вам
Код:
   for(int i = 0; i < n; i++)  
   { 
    mas[i] = a;  
    } 
for(int i = 0; i < n; i++)  
   { 
    cout << mas[i] <<endl;  //endl нужно, если хотите 
                                     //чтобы каждое число с новой строки выводилось.
    }
"Заполнение массива, одинаковым числом" это код Вам уже многоуважаемая ACE Valery написала. Я лишь добавил как его отобразить
//Не удачно влез к вам Не успел...

Последний раз редактировалось Rembo; 01.06.2008 в 19:49.
Rembo вне форума Ответить с цитированием
Старый 01.06.2008, 19:50   #13
alexs2141
Пользователь
 
Регистрация: 01.06.2008
Сообщений: 45
По умолчанию

и если можно то на с++
alexs2141 вне форума Ответить с цитированием
Старый 01.06.2008, 19:51   #14
Rembo
Форумчанин
 
Аватар для Rembo
 
Регистрация: 29.10.2007
Сообщений: 628
По умолчанию

alexs2141 мы тебе и написали на С++! это Вы с другой темой перепутали...

Последний раз редактировалось Rembo; 01.06.2008 в 19:53.
Rembo вне форума Ответить с цитированием
Старый 01.06.2008, 20:22   #15
alexs2141
Пользователь
 
Регистрация: 01.06.2008
Сообщений: 45
По умолчанию

не получается может что еще прописать надо?
alexs2141 вне форума Ответить с цитированием
Старый 01.06.2008, 20:34   #16
ACE Valery
Сама себе режиссер
Старожил
 
Аватар для ACE Valery
 
Регистрация: 27.04.2007
Сообщений: 3,365
По умолчанию

Давайте полный код и текст всех ошибок, выскакивающих при компиляции.
Если я вас напрягаю или раздражаю, вы всегда можете забиться в угол и поплакать
ACE Valery вне форума Ответить с цитированием
Старый 01.06.2008, 20:47   #17
merax
Форумчанин
 
Регистрация: 27.12.2006
Сообщений: 955
По умолчанию

Подозреваю, что у него проблема с границами массива.

Вот ето "плохой код", для определения границ массива желательно использовать константы !!!

Код:
#include <conio>
#include <iostream>

using namespace std;

int main()
{
        const max = 10;

        int array[max];

        for (int i = 0; i < max; i++)
        {
                array[i] = (i);
        }

        for (int i = 0; i < max; i++)
        {
                std::cout << array[i];
        }

        getch();

return 0;
}

Последний раз редактировалось merax; 01.06.2008 в 20:50.
merax вне форума Ответить с цитированием
Старый 01.06.2008, 20:49   #18
alexs2141
Пользователь
 
Регистрация: 01.06.2008
Сообщений: 45
По умолчанию

Код:
#include<stdio.h>
 #include<iostream.h>
 void main()
  {

   int x,y,z,d;
     char otv;


  float moment,raznostmoment,izmobr,oboroti;


  printf("wibran  regim 4astu4nix nagruzok \n");

      do
      {
   printf("vvedite procent otkritiya droselya \n");
    scanf("%d",&d);
    if(d>=76 && d<=100){
  printf("ўўҐ¤ЁвҐ ®Ў®а®вл \n");
  scanf("%d",&y);
  if (y>0 && y<=2200)   {

  moment=-0.00005*y*y+0.21*y-111.9;  }
   if (y>2200 && y<=4600) {
   moment=-0.000001*y*y+0.0093*y+89.968;
   }
    if (y>4600 && y<=6000) {
   moment=-0.000016*y*y+0.1578*y-273.51;
   }

  printf("momint %f\n",moment);
   printf("vvedite moment nagruzki\n ");
  scanf("%d",&z);
  raznostmoment=moment-z;
  printf("raznost momintov %f\n",raznostmoment);
  izmobr=0.002*raznostmoment*raznostmoment*raznostmoment;
   printf("izmenenie oborotov %f\n",izmobr);
   oboroti=y+izmobr;
   printf(" oboroti dvigatelya %f\n",oboroti);}

     for(int i = 0; i < 6; i++)
   {
    mas[i] = a;
    }
for(int i = 0; i < 6; i++)
   {
    cout << mas[i] <<endl;


   cout<<"prodolgit? Yes\No "<<endl;
             cin>>otv;
      } while (otv!='n');
     getchar();



  printf("finish :\n");
  scanf("%f",&x);

  }
ошибки при компиляции
1) undefinded simbol "mas"
2) undefinded simbol "mas"
3) code has no effect
4) do ststement must have while
5) Compound statement missing }

Используйте тег <CODE>

Последний раз редактировалось merax; 01.06.2008 в 20:54.
alexs2141 вне форума Ответить с цитированием
Старый 01.06.2008, 20:54   #19
alexs2141
Пользователь
 
Регистрация: 01.06.2008
Сообщений: 45
По умолчанию

вот полный текст проги значение oboroti нужно забить в строчный массив длинной 7 элементов и выдать на экран

#include<stdio.h>
#include<iostream.h>
void main()
{

int x,y,z,d;
char otv;


float moment,raznostmoment,izmobr,oboroti ;


printf("wibran regim 4astu4nix nagruzok \n");

do
{
printf("vvedite procent otkritiya droselya \n");
scanf("%d",&d);
if(d>=76 && d<=100){
printf("ўўҐ¤ЁвҐ ®Ў®а®вл \n");
scanf("%d",&y);
if (y>0 && y<=2200) {

moment=-0.00005*y*y+0.21*y-111.9; }
if (y>2200 && y<=4600) {
moment=-0.000001*y*y+0.0093*y+89.968;
}
if (y>4600 && y<=6000) {
moment=-0.000016*y*y+0.1578*y-273.51;
}

printf("momint %f\n",moment);
printf("vvedite moment nagruzki\n ");
scanf("%d",&z);
raznostmoment=moment-z;
printf("raznost momintov %f\n",raznostmoment);
izmobr=0.002*raznostmoment*raznostm oment*raznostmoment;
printf("izmenenie oborotov %f\n",izmobr);
oboroti=y+izmobr;
printf(" oboroti dvigatelya %f\n",oboroti);}

for(int i = 0; i < 6; i++)
{
mas[i] = oboroti;
}
for(int i = 0; i < 6; i++)
{
cout << mas[i] <<endl;


cout<<"prodolgit? Yes\No "<<endl;
cin>>otv;
} while (otv!='n');
getchar();



printf("finish :\n");
scanf("%f",&x);

}
ошибки при компиляции
1) undefinded simbol "mas"
2) undefinded simbol "mas"
3) code has no effect
4) do ststement must have while
5) Compound statement missing }
alexs2141 вне форума Ответить с цитированием
Старый 01.06.2008, 20:57   #20
ACE Valery
Сама себе режиссер
Старожил
 
Аватар для ACE Valery
 
Регистрация: 27.04.2007
Сообщений: 3,365
По умолчанию

Я не вижу в коде объявления массива. И записываете вы в него какую-то несуществующую переменную а. Вам же надо записывать что-то другое, верно?
Если я вас напрягаю или раздражаю, вы всегда можете забиться в угол и поплакать
ACE Valery в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Подскажите пожалуйста новичку в С++ как написать программку saratovalex Помощь студентам 3 21.08.2008 11:06
подскажите пожалуйста новичку alexs2141 Общие вопросы Delphi 6 04.06.2008 23:49
пожалуйста подскажите новичку alexs2141 Помощь студентам 8 01.06.2008 21:31
подскажите с чего начать новичку ben95 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M 1 14.05.2008 15:02